> > What difference in throuput can one expect between ht/20 and a ht/40 ?
>
> If you're hitting best possible circumstances? Almost 2x.
>
Is this more or less the troughput what one should expect:
a/20 = 29.7 Mbits/sec
ht/20 = 40.6 Mbits/sec
ht/40 = 44.1 Mbits/sec
HW = gateworks ARM
OS = FreeBSD 10.0-CURRENT (from 2012/10/11)
Build = arm-10-20121011
Wifi = RouterBOARD R52nM = AR9220
